Oil and Gas Commission - Archaeology __ "Archaeology is the study of past
human behaviour. Studies are conducted through the examination of preserved
materials (artifacts) and activity indicators (rock art, culturally modified
trees, etc.). This cultural heritage is protected in British Columbia by the
Heritage Conservation Act, 1996, which applies to both Crown and private land.
Sites pre-dating 1846 are protected under this Act." Learn of its association
